Make PipelineRun parameterized support
Fix wrong format of PipelineRun template Fix unquoted error of parameter value Refine parameter flag Remove unused parameter type Add some tests against PipelineRun template parsing Remove unused method

@@ -0,0 +1,136 @@ | ||
package pipeline | ||
|
||
import ( | ||
"bytes" | ||
"fmt" | ||
"github.com/stretchr/testify/assert" | ||
"html/template" | ||
"k8s.io/apimachinery/pkg/apis/meta/v1/unstructured" | ||
"sigs.k8s.io/yaml" | ||
"testing" | ||
) | ||
|
||
func TestPipelineRunTplParse(t *testing.T) { | ||
tpl := template.New("PipelineRunTpl") | ||
tpl, err := tpl.Parse(pipelineRunTpl) | ||
if err != nil { | ||
t.Errorf("failed to parse PipelineRun template, err = %v", err) | ||
} | ||
var buf bytes.Buffer | ||
err = tpl.Execute(&buf, map[string]interface{}{ | ||
"name": "fake_name", | ||
"namespace": "fake_ns", | ||
"parameters": nil, | ||
}) | ||
if err != nil { | ||
t.Errorf("failed to execute PipelineRun template, err = %v", err) | ||
} | ||
fmt.Println(buf.String()) | ||
} | ||
|
||
// getNestedString comes from k8s.io/[email protected]/pkg/apis/meta/v1/unstructured/helpers.go:277 | ||
func getNestedString(obj map[string]interface{}, fields ...string) string { | ||
val, found, err := unstructured.NestedString(obj, fields...) | ||
if !found || err != nil { | ||
return "" | ||
} | ||
return val | ||
} | ||
|
||
func getNestSlice(obj map[string]interface{}, fields ...string) []interface{} { | ||
val, found, err := unstructured.NestedSlice(obj, fields...) | ||
if !found || err != nil { | ||
return nil | ||
} | ||
return val | ||
} | ||
|
||
func Test_parsePipelineRunTpl(t *testing.T) { | ||
type args struct { | ||
data map[string]interface{} | ||
} | ||
tests := []struct { | ||
name string | ||
args args | ||
pipelineRunAssert func(obj *unstructured.Unstructured) | ||
wantErr bool | ||
}{{ | ||
name: "Without parameters", | ||
args: args{ | ||
data: map[string]interface{}{ | ||
"name": "fake_name", | ||
"namespace": "fake_namespace", | ||
}, | ||
}, | ||
pipelineRunAssert: func(obj *unstructured.Unstructured) { | ||
assert.Equal(t, "fake_name", obj.GetGenerateName()) | ||
assert.Equal(t, "fake_namespace", obj.GetNamespace()) | ||
assert.Equal(t, "fake_name", getNestedString(obj.Object, "spec", "pipelineRef", "name")) | ||
assert.Equal(t, 0, len(getNestSlice(obj.Object, "spec", "parameters"))) | ||
}, | ||
}, { | ||
name: "With nil parameters", | ||
args: args{ | ||
data: map[string]interface{}{ | ||
"name": "fake_name", | ||
"namespace": "fake_namespace", | ||
"parameters": nil, | ||
}, | ||
}, | ||
pipelineRunAssert: func(obj *unstructured.Unstructured) { | ||
assert.Equal(t, "fake_name", obj.GetGenerateName()) | ||
assert.Equal(t, "fake_namespace", obj.GetNamespace()) | ||
assert.Equal(t, "fake_name", getNestedString(obj.Object, "spec", "pipelineRef", "name")) | ||
assert.Equal(t, 0, len(getNestSlice(obj.Object, "spec", "parameters"))) | ||
}, | ||
}, { | ||
name: "With empty parameters", | ||
args: args{ | ||
data: map[string]interface{}{ | ||
"name": "fake_name", | ||
"namespace": "fake_namespace", | ||
"parameters": map[string]string{}, | ||
}, | ||
}, | ||
pipelineRunAssert: func(obj *unstructured.Unstructured) { | ||
assert.Equal(t, "fake_name", obj.GetGenerateName()) | ||
assert.Equal(t, "fake_namespace", obj.GetNamespace()) | ||
assert.Equal(t, "fake_name", getNestedString(obj.Object, "spec", "pipelineRef", "name")) | ||
assert.Equal(t, 0, len(getNestSlice(obj.Object, "spec", "parameters"))) | ||
}, | ||
}, { | ||
name: "With one parameter", | ||
args: args{ | ||
data: map[string]interface{}{ | ||
"name": "fake_name", | ||
"namespace": "fake_namespace", | ||
"parameters": map[string]string{ | ||
"a": "b", | ||
}, | ||
}, | ||
}, | ||
pipelineRunAssert: func(obj *unstructured.Unstructured) { | ||
assert.Equal(t, "fake_name", obj.GetGenerateName()) | ||
assert.Equal(t, "fake_namespace", obj.GetNamespace()) | ||
assert.Equal(t, "fake_name", getNestedString(obj.Object, "spec", "pipelineRef", "name")) | ||
assert.Equal(t, 1, len(getNestSlice(obj.Object, "spec", "parameters"))) | ||
assert.Equal(t, map[string]interface{}{"name": "a", "value": "b"}, getNestSlice(obj.Object, "spec", "parameters")[0]) | ||
}, | ||
}} | ||
for _, tt := range tests { | ||
t.Run(tt.name, func(t *testing.T) { | ||
gotPipelineRunYaml, err := parsePipelineRunTpl(tt.args.data) | ||
if (err != nil) != tt.wantErr { | ||
t.Errorf("parsePipelineRunTpl() error = %v, wantErr %v", err, tt.wantErr) | ||
return | ||
} | ||
obj := unstructured.Unstructured{} | ||
err = yaml.Unmarshal([]byte(gotPipelineRunYaml), &obj) | ||
if (err != nil) != tt.wantErr { | ||
t.Errorf("parsePipelineRunTpl() error = %v, wantErr %v", err, tt.wantErr) | ||
return | ||
} | ||
tt.pipelineRunAssert(&obj) | ||
}) | ||
} | ||
} |
